This study aims to compare the Weighted Moving Average and Single Exponential Smoothing algorithms in forecasting room reservations at Raz Hotel and Convention Medan using historical data from January 2025 to May 2026. The research method consisted of data collection, forecasting using both algorithms, and accuracy evaluation through Mean Absolute Deviation, Mean Squared Error, and Mean Absolute Percentage Error. The results indicate that the Single Exponential Smoothing algorithm achieved a Mean Absolute Percentage Error of 15.24%, which is lower than the 15.63% obtained by the Weighted Moving Average algorithm. Furthermore, the Single Exponential Smoothing algorithm predicted 835.90 room reservations for June 2026. Therefore, it can be concluded that the Single Exponential Smoothing algorithm provides better forecasting accuracy and is more suitable for predicting room reservations at Raz Hotel and Convention Medan.

This study aims to implement and analyze the accuracy of the Single Moving Average (SMA) quantitative forecasting method in predicting Sate Padang Hapis sales volumes for June 2026. Model performance was evaluated by assessing mathematical accuracy across two time-interval variations: 3-month and 5-month moving averages. Projection error rates were rigorously measured using Mean Absolute Deviation (MAD), Mean Squared Error (MSE), and Mean Absolute Percentage Error (MAPE) parameters. The analysis reveals that the Single Moving Average model with a 5-month interval yields projections closest to actual data, achieving the lowest error rates (MAD: 28.00; MSE: 1,304.00; MAPE: 2.28%). Implementing this forecasting model provides management with an objective basis for decision-making, enabling the effective and efficient optimization of raw material logistics and supply management.

Accuracy was evaluated using Mean Absolute Deviation, Mean Squared Error, and Mean Absolute Percentage Error. The results show that the forecasted rice stock requirement for July 2026 is 1,456.67 kg. The accuracy evaluation yielded a Mean Absolute Deviation of 78.22, Mean Squared Error of 9,288.15, and Mean Absolute Percentage Error of 5.71%, which is classified as highly accurate. In conclusion, the Weighted Moving Average method is suitable as a decision-support tool for rice stock management at Warung Grosir Giran.

The analysis results show that in analog signals, noise causes permanent waveform distortion that is difficult to recover. In contrast, digital signals tend to maintain data integrity as long as the interference does not exceed a certain threshold. These differences in signal characteristics can be visually observed through waveform displays in the software. The results indicate that digital systems have advantages in maintaining signal quality in noisy environments and have the potential to be used as educational media for basic telecommunication and signal processing studies.

This study aims to implement a web-based alumni and career tracking information system to improve the effectiveness of alumni data management, facilitate communication between the school and alumni, and support graduate career tracking. The research methods used include observation and interviews with school staff and alumni. The system was developed using PHP programming language and MySQL database, with system design based on Unified Modeling Language (UML). The results show that the developed system is able to manage alumni data centrally, provide career path information, and generate accurate and accessible alumni reports. Therefore, this system can serve as an effective solution to improve alumni information services at SMK Negeri 1 Kisaran

The system development adopts the Waterfall methodology, which includes requirement analysis, UML-based system design (Use Case, Class, Activity, and Sequence Diagrams), implementation using PHP, MySQL, and the CodeIgniter framework, as well as functional testing through the black-box method. The results show that the system provides core features such as inventory management, borrowing transactions, and automated reporting. System testing indicates improved data accuracy, a 70% increase in search efficiency, and enhanced transparency in laboratory asset management. Overall, the system enables a more organized, accountable administrative process and supports the campus digitalization program.
